The old dies so that the new might be born.—Gloria Karpinski Many people pressure their friends and partners to meet all of their needs. But it is important to remember that there are countless ways to meet any need. When we limit the options available to us, we limit our opportunities. Often, when we are angry with another person, we want them to hear us. But they may not be willing or able to hear us. Still, we keep going back to them and receiving the same response. We won’t meet our need, though, because it doesn’t occur to us to ask elsewhere. If you find yourself in a situation like this, consider going to another person who is more likely to hear you. You may be surprised how healing this can be. When we are open to all the possibilities available to us, we become more successful at meeting our needs and living happier lives.
